TimeOS

TimeOS is an AI meeting assistant that automatically records, transcribes, and summarizes meetings, helping teams save time and stay organized. It generates action items, highlights key discussions, and integrates with tools like Zoom, Google Meet, Microsoft Teams, Notion, and Slack. This review covers TimeOS pricing, features, pros and cons, top alternatives, and whether it's the right solution for professionals, remote teams, and businesses.

How TimeOS Works

  • Calendar Integration: Links with calendars such as Google Calendar to monitor upcoming meetings, schedules, and associated meeting links.
  • Meeting Capture: Uses an AI meeting assistant or browser-based tools to join supported video calls, record conversations, and transcribe discussions as they happen.
  • AI-Powered Summaries: Analyzes meeting conversations to produce organized notes, important highlights, key decisions, and concise summaries in multiple languages.
  • Action Item Management: Identifies commitments and next steps from conversations, converts them into tasks, prepares follow-up messages, and can send relevant information to tools such as Slack, Notion, and project management platforms.
  • Intelligent Organization: Organizes related meetings and conversations into topic- or client-based spaces, allowing AI agents to automate follow-ups and create workflows based on meeting content.
